OverviewDesire at Henley opens on a single weekend at one of England's most storied sporting events, where three men navigate the particular freedoms and complications of a life lived just outside the mainstream. Brian, a professional fundraiser with an acute awareness of appearances, finds himself suspended between the easy intimacy of his throuple with rowers Finn and Aly, and the unexpected arrival of Archie, a groundsman and PhD student who moves through the world with a quiet certainty Brian has never quite managed himself. Set against the champagne-soaked enclosures of Henley Royal Regatta, the ancient country lanes of Oxfordshire and the unhurried rhythms of rural cottage life, this is a novel about class, desire and the slow work of figuring out what you actually want. It is frank about sex and tender about love, interested in the gap between the two, and quietly attentive to the social codes that govern who gets to be visible and on whose terms.
